How common are IVF mistakes?
IVF errors are rare. A study published last year found that between 2009 and 2019, out of approximately 2.5 million IVF procedures in the U.S., 133 errors happened that resulted in lawsuits — 87 of which involved two alleged freezer tank failures in 2018 and 2019.2021-12-04

Does IVF usually work the first time?
Overall, for women starting IVF, 33% have a baby as a result of their first cycle, increasing to 54-77% by the eighth cycle. Our research, published today, reports the probability of IVF success from a patient’s perspective after repeated cycles, rather than how it is usually reported, for each cycle.2017-07-23
Why is IVF success rate so low?
IVF can fail due to embryos that have chromosomal abnormalities. This means that the embryo has a missing, extra, or irregular portion of chromosomal DNA. The body then rejects the embryo and this results in IVF failure.2020-09-03
Does insurance cover IVF cost?
In states without any infertility coverage mandate, most insurance plans do not help much with payment for fertility and IVF services. IVF insurance coverage is less common than coverage for fertility services other than IVF. This is because IVF costs more than other infertility testing and treatments.

How often does IVF fail the first time?
IVF success rates depend on many factors, such as age and the reasons for infertility. Overall, first-time IVF success rates often fall between 25-30% for most intended parents. However, this probability tends to increase after multiple IVF cycles.
How successful is the first round of IVF?
Getting Pregnant After One Cycle of IVF Females under the age of 30 have a 46 percent chance of getting pregnant after their first IVF cycle (this could mean a few embryo transfers some of them frozen), while females between the ages of 40 and 43 have a less than 12 percent chance of success.
How long after a failed IVF Can I try again?
A fresh IVF cycle should not be done two months in a row without a menstrual cycle in between them. That means waiting about 4 to 6 weeks after the embryo transfer and negative pregnancy test to start another full cycle for most women.2020-04-30
